These Red Pandas Are SO Excited About The Snow

These red pandas sure know how to make the most of the recent Arctic blast.

Lissa Browning, a zookeeper at the Cincinnati Zoo & Botanical Garden, captured a video of two red pandas frolicking in the snow after a recent snowfall in Ohio, according to ABC News. Lin, 2, and Rover, 9, can be seen running, jumping and swinging in the frost-covered trees in the adorable minute-long video.

The zoo's website states that red pandas are able to stay warm in the cold weather thanks to thick tails that can wrap around their bodies.
